Output 128b9817f33160480e44bf8602fec61c3822f5a9d9b56a9e8d54d42b22b89e73:1

value
34304322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dac5f36d85417ba9ff2a0c87267691d59d9fd47b OP_EQUAL
address
3MdnNEPpM9vtWjbfN9PdFr3niS5g843PTQ
transaction
128b9817f33160480e44bf8602fec61c3822f5a9d9b56a9e8d54d42b22b89e73